Jak zjistit v Pythonu jestli proměnná obsahuje celé čislo
Ahoj, jak můžu prosím zjistit v Pythonu jestli proměnná obsahuje celé čislo. Děkuji
Ahoj, jak můžu prosím zjistit v Pythonu jestli proměnná obsahuje celé čislo. Děkuji
Předmět | Autor | Datum |
---|---|---|
https://note.nkmk.me/en/python-check-int-float/ Wikan 15.01.2022 14:37 |
Wikan | |
Díky a co z toho nejlépe použít? pman 15.01.2022 14:41 |
pman | |
To co se nejlépe hodí pro tvou situaci. Wikan 15.01.2022 15:01 |
Wikan | |
A můžeš mi doporučit co použít? Vždy budu dělit celé číslo číslem 2, bude tedy výsledek vždy celé čí… pman 15.01.2022 15:10 |
pman | |
Pokud budes delit, bude vysledek realne cisli bez ohledu na to, jestli za desetinnou carkou bude nul… Jan Fiala 15.01.2022 15:54 |
Jan Fiala | |
V tom případě is_integer(). Wikan 15.01.2022 16:09 |
Wikan | |
Děkuji, zkusím. pman 17.01.2022 11:53 |
pman | |
ekvivalent Parse int
nebo algoritmem prom%1==prom poslední ujoPolak 18.01.2022 13:54 |
ujoPolak |
Zpět do poradny Odpovědět na původní otázku Nahoru
https://note.nkmk.me/en/python-check-int-float/
Díky a co z toho nejlépe použít?
To co se nejlépe hodí pro tvou situaci.
A můžeš mi doporučit co použít? Vždy budu dělit celé číslo číslem 2, bude tedy výsledek vždy celé číslo (x nebo x.0) nebo číslo (x.5) jiná možnost v mém případě nenastane. Děkuji.
Pokud budes delit, bude vysledek realne cisli bez ohledu na to, jestli za desetinnou carkou bude nula nebo ne.
Pokud chces otestovat, jestli nejaky zbytek je nebo neni, muzes treba porovnat, jestli vysledek = Round(vysledej)
V tom případě is_integer().
Děkuji, zkusím.
ekvivalent Parse int
nebo algoritmem prom%1==prom